An automatic spraying device for zinc oxide resistors in lightning arresters
By designing an automatic spraying device, the problem of spraying the inner and outer walls of the zinc oxide resistor of the lightning arrester was solved, the synchronous spraying and drying process was achieved, and the spraying efficiency and paint adhesion effect were improved.

The existing technology cannot effectively spray specific coatings on the inner and outer walls of the zinc oxide resistor of the lightning arrester, especially the clamping or flipping method cannot achieve comprehensive spraying of the inner and outer walls.
An automatic spraying device for zinc oxide resistor sheets in lightning arresters was designed, which included a retention box, a conveying platform, a pushing plate, a driving mechanism, a conveying assembly, and a spraying mechanism. The inner and outer walls of the resistor sheet were sprayed by the pushing of the pushing plate and the cooperation of the driving mechanism, and the rotation of the adsorption assembly and the supporting base tube enabled the resistor sheet to be sprayed in a rotational manner.
The synchronous spraying of the inner and outer walls of the resistor sheet is achieved, which improves the comprehensiveness and efficiency of the spraying, reduces the debugging cost, and ensures the adhesion effect of the paint through the drying treatment of the conveying component.

[0001] The present invention relates to the technical field related to spraying, and in particular to an automatic spraying device for zinc oxide resistor sheets of a lightning arrester. Background Art
[0002] The function of a lightning arrester is to protect various electrical equipment in the power system from damage caused by lightning overvoltage, operating overvoltage, and power frequency transient overvoltage.
[0003] The main types of lightning arresters include protective gaps, valve-type lightning arresters, and zinc oxide lightning arresters. Protective gaps are mainly used to limit atmospheric overvoltages and are generally used for protection of distribution systems, lines, and substation incoming line segments. Valve-type lightning arresters and zinc oxide lightning arresters are used to protect substations and power plants. In systems of 500kV and below, they are mainly used to limit atmospheric overvoltages. In ultra-high voltage systems, they are also used to limit internal overvoltages or serve as backup protection for internal overvoltages.
[0004] A crucial component of a lightning arrester is the internal resistor. To prevent rust from forming over time, which could affect the arrester's function, the internal and external surfaces of the resistor are typically coated with a specific coating during production. This not only prevents rust but also improves the arrester's stability.
[0005] The search disclosed a clamping mechanism and a cross-section spraying device for zinc oxide resistors used in lightning arresters, with publication number CN219816721U, and a cross-section aluminum spraying device for zinc oxide resistors, with publication number CN214107587U.
[0006] Including but not limited to the above two patents, both of them are for spraying the end faces of the resistor, that is, the top and the bottom. Therefore, the above patents cannot achieve the problem raised by this application "spraying specific coatings on the inner and outer walls of the resistor."
[0007] Moreover, the above patent adopts a clamping or flipping method for spraying, and cannot be associated with the spraying of inner and outer walls. Summary of the Invention

[0055] The following is based on Figures 1-15 The invention describes an automatic spraying device for zinc oxide resistor sheets of a lightning arrester provided by an embodiment of the invention.
[0056] See also Figures 1-15The embodiment of the present invention provides a technical solution: an automatic spraying device for zinc oxide resistor sheets of a lightning arrester, comprising a retention box 1 and a support leg fixed to the bottom of the retention box 1 for fixing, and also comprising a conveying platform 101 fixed to one side of the retention box 1, a through port 104 opened on the conveying platform 101, and a conveying assembly. A push port is opened on the retention box 1, and a push plate 2 is slidably installed between the push port and the conveying platform 101. No. 2 electric push rods 7 are fixed on both sides of the conveying platform 101, and the movable rods of the two No. 2 electric push rods 7 are fixed to the ends of the push plate 2. A spraying mechanism is installed on the conveying platform 101.
[0057] A driving mechanism is installed at the bottom of the retention box 1 just below the through port 104 , and the driving mechanism cooperates with the spraying mechanism to complete the spraying work on the inner and outer walls of the resistor body 5 .
[0058] The conveying assembly is installed on one side of the retention box 1 and cooperates with the conveying platform 101.
[0059] In the embodiment of the present invention, the resistor body 5 is sequentially placed into the retention box 1 for stacking by a related placing device, and then the push plate 2 is driven to slide along its length direction by the operation of the second electric push rod 7 .
[0060] The resistor body 5 at the bottom of the retention box 1 will be pushed to the position of the through opening 104 by the pushing plate 2. During this process, the resistor body 5 in the retention box 1 that has not entered the push opening position is blocked. When the pushing plate 2 moves back and forth to the starting position of the stroke, the blocking of the resistor body 5 in the retention box 1 is released, and the resistor body 5 in the retention box 1 naturally falls to the push opening position. The reciprocating movement of the pushing plate 2 can realize the sequential pushing of the resistor body 5 in the retention box 1.
[0061] Through the cooperation of the spraying mechanism and the driving mechanism, a resistor body 5 at the position of the through opening 104 is driven to rise slightly and rotate at the same time, thereby achieving the spraying work on the inner wall and the outer wall of the resistor body 5.
[0062] Secondly, after the spraying work on the resistor body 5 is completed, the resistor body 5 after spraying will be pushed onto the conveying assembly through the continued movement of the pushing plate 2, so as to be transported to the subsequent process through the conveying assembly.
[0063] It should be noted that the height of the push port on the retention box 1 is greater than the height of a single resistor body 5 and less than the height of two resistor body 5 .
[0064] The conveying assembly includes a conveying frame 4 arranged on one side of the retention box 1. Conveying rollers 402 are rotatably installed at both ends of the conveying frame 4. The two conveying rollers 402 are connected by a conveyor belt 401.
[0065] A No. 1 motor 403 is fixed on the conveyor frame 4 , and an output shaft of the No. 1 motor 403 is coaxially fixed with one of the conveying rollers 402 .
[0066] The conveyor belt 401 is provided with through holes at equal intervals along the conveying path, and a plurality of fans 404 are installed in the conveyor frame 4 .
[0067] In an embodiment of the present invention, when motor No. 1 403 is working, it drives one of the conveying rollers 402 to rotate through its output shaft, so as to drive the conveyor belt 401 to convey through one of the conveying rollers 402, and at the same time drives the other conveying roller 402 to rotate synchronously, so as to drive the conveyor belt 401 to convey through the operation of motor No. 1 403.
[0068] The conveying of the resistor body 5 after processing is achieved by the conveying of the conveying belt 401 and by pushing the pushing plate 2 after spraying onto the conveying belt 401 by the pushing plate 2 .
[0069] The fan 404 can generate cold air or hot air to dry the resistor body 5 conveyed on the conveyor belt 401 .

[0071] The driving mechanism includes a receiving frame 6 fixed to the bottom of the conveying platform 101 , on which a driving sleeve 6014 is rotatably mounted. The driving sleeve 6014 is coaxially arranged with the through opening 104 .
[0072] The bearing base pipe 601 is slidably installed in the driving sleeve 6014 , and the bearing base pipe 601 and the driving sleeve 6014 are engaged with each other via a transmission member.
[0073] The transmission member includes a plurality of transmission bars 6012 fixed to the outer wall of the supporting base pipe 601 at equal intervals around the circumference. The transmission bars 6012 are slidably engaged with transmission grooves 6013 formed on the inner wall of the driving sleeve 6014 .
[0074] An adsorption assembly is installed on the supporting base tube 601 , and the supporting base tube 601 is also connected to the pushing plate 2 via a lifting assembly.
[0075] The driving sleeve 6014 is connected to a driving member installed at the bottom of the conveying platform 101 .
[0076] In an embodiment of the present invention, when the resistor body 5 is pushed to the position of the through opening 104, the supporting base tube 601 is first driven to rise by the lifting assembly, so that the adsorption assembly is driven to rise by the rising of the supporting base tube 601. When the supporting base tube 601 and the adsorption assembly rise to the end of the stroke, the resistor body 5 is slightly lifted up and the resistor body 5 is adsorbed.
[0077] After completing the above process, the driving member works to drive the driving sleeve 6014 to rotate. When the driving sleeve 6014 rotates, the transmission groove 6013 and the transmission bar 6012 cooperate to drive the supporting base tube 601 to rotate. At the same time, the resistor body 5 is driven to rotate through the adsorption component. When the resistor body 5 rotates, the spraying work is performed through the spraying mechanism.
[0078] The effect achieved by the cooperation between the transmission bar 6012 and the transmission groove 6013 is that when the driving sleeve 6014 rotates, the supporting base tube 601 can be synchronously driven to rotate. At the same time, the supporting base tube 601 does not lose the synchronous rotation relationship when sliding along its axial direction.
[0079] It should also be noted that when the supporting base tube 601 rises to the end of its stroke, the top of the supporting base tube 601 is actually in contact with the bottom of the conveying platform 101, which is equivalent to installing a supporting base tube 601 connected to the bottom of the through opening 104. The effect of this state is specifically explained in the spraying mechanism.
[0080] The driving member includes a transmission shaft 603 rotatably mounted on the receiving frame 6 , a driving gear 605 is coaxially fixed to the bottom end of the transmission shaft 603 , and a driven gear ring 606 meshing with the driving gear 605 is coaxially fixed to the driving sleeve 6014 .
[0081] A second motor 602 is fixed at the bottom of the conveying platform 101 , and an output shaft of the second motor 602 is connected to a transmission shaft 603 via a bevel gear set 604 .
[0082] In an embodiment of the present invention, when the second motor 602 is working, its output shaft drives the transmission shaft 603 to rotate through the bevel gear set 604, so as to synchronously drive the driving gear 605 to rotate when the transmission shaft 603 rotates, and then drive the driving sleeve 6014 to rotate through the engagement of the driving gear 605 and the driven gear ring 606.
[0083] During the driving process, the driving gear 605 and the driven gear ring 606 form a large and small gear transmission relationship, thereby achieving the effect of speed reduction and torque increase, making the driving more powerful and stable.
[0084] It should also be noted that the bevel gear set 604 includes two bevel gears meshing with each other, and the two bevel gears are coaxially fixed to the output shaft of the second motor 602 and the transmission shaft 603 respectively.
[0085] The suction assembly includes multiple suction cups 609 equidistantly fixed around the carrier tube 601, and a negative pressure pumping unit 608 fixed to the bottom of the conveyor platform 101. The multiple suction cups 609 are connected to and communicate with the negative pressure pumping unit 608 via a negative pressure air pipe. The negative pressure pumping unit 608 includes a vacuum pump and a negative pressure tank. The vacuum pump input port is connected to the negative pressure tank, and the multiple suction cups 609 are connected to the negative pressure tank via the negative pressure air pipe.
[0086] In an embodiment of the present invention, when the supporting base tube 601 rises to the end of its stroke, multiple suction cups 609 all abut against the bottom of the resistor body 5. The negative pressure pumping unit 608 uses a negative pressure air pipe to pump negative pressure onto the suction cups 609, so that the suction cups 609 adsorb the resistor body 5, causing the resistor body 5 to rotate along with the supporting base tube 601.
[0087] Among them, the adsorption fixation method can be used for rapid fixation when needed, and is more efficient and more accurate than clamping.

[0089] The lifting assembly includes a transmission frame 607 rotatably mounted on the supporting base pipe 601 , and pulling cables 707 are fixed on both sides of the top of the transmission frame 607 .
[0090] Winding rollers 706 are rotatably installed on both sides of the conveyor platform 101. The pulling steel cable 707 is wound onto the winding rollers 706 through multiple guide wheels 708 rotatably installed on the conveyor platform 101. The two winding rollers 706 are connected to the push plate 2 through a symmetrically arranged transmission assembly.
[0091] In the embodiment of the present invention, when the pushing plate 2 is working, the winding roller 706 is driven to rotate by the transmission assembly, and the pulling steel cable 707 is wound by the rotation of the winding roller 706, thereby pulling the transmission frame 607 to drive the supporting base pipe 601 to rise upright.
[0092] As is known to all, the debugging of the driving device is relatively cumbersome. In this embodiment, the transmission component is driven to work by the necessary action of pushing the resistor body 5 by the pushing plate 2, and the winding roller 706 is driven to rotate by the transmission component, so that the lifting and lowering of the supporting base tube 601 can be achieved by winding the winding roller 706. The same technical effect can be achieved while reducing the use of driving components.
[0093] The transmission assembly includes a worm wheel 705 coaxially fixed on the winding roller 706. A worm 704 that cooperates with the worm wheel 705 is rotatably mounted on one side of the worm wheel 705. A ratchet wheel 702 is coaxially fixed on the worm 704.
[0094] A gear set 7010 is also rotatably mounted on the conveyor platform 101 . The gear set 7010 includes a first gear and a second gear that mesh with each other. A second ratchet 709 is coaxially fixed to the first gear. The second gear is connected to the worm 704 through a transmission chain 703 .
[0095] A push-pull plate 701 fixed to the pushing plate 2 is slidably mounted on the conveying platform 101 , and a ratchet pawl that unidirectionally cooperates with the second ratchet 709 or the first ratchet 702 is mounted on the push-pull plate 701 .
[0096] In the embodiment of the present invention, when the pushing plate 2 moves, the push-pull plate 701 is driven to follow the synchronous movement.
[0097] When the pushing plate 2 moves, the single resistor body 5 is first pushed to the position of the through port 104. At the same time, the push-pull plate 701 moves synchronously with the pushing plate 2. During this movement, the pawl of the push-pull plate 701 does not have a transmission relationship with the second ratchet 709 and the first ratchet 702. When the resistor body 5 moves to the position of the through port 104, the push-pull plate 701 moves back and forth for a certain distance. During this process, the pawl of the push-pull plate 701 cooperates with the first ratchet 702 to drive the first ratchet 702 and the worm 704 to rotate, so as to drive the worm wheel 705 and the winding roller 706 to rotate through the cooperation between the worm 704 and the worm wheel 705. When the winding roller 706 rotates, the pulling cable 707 is wound, and the corresponding supporting base tube 601 rises.
[0098] Of course, the first ratchet 702 and the second ratchet 709 can be replaced with gears, in which case the pawls need to be replaced with racks, and both the first ratchet 702 and the second ratchet 709 are mounted via a ratchet mechanism to achieve one-way transmission. That is, gears are rotatably mounted on both the worm 704 and the first gear, a rack meshing with the gears is mounted on the push-pull plate 701, and ratchet mechanisms are installed between the worm 704 and the corresponding gear, and between the first gear and the corresponding gear, to achieve one-way transmission.
[0099] Among them, after the resistor body 5 is pushed to the position of the opening 104, the purpose of the reciprocating movement of a certain distance is that since the pushing plate 2 and the resistor body 5 are in abutment relationship when pushing the resistor body 5, the subsequent spraying work is carried out by rotating the resistor body 5, thereby preventing the paint from falling off due to friction between the rotating resistor body 5 and the pushing plate 2 when the paint is not firmly attached.
[0100] After the spraying of the resistor body 5 is completed, the push plate 2 retreats again by a certain distance. This retreat triggers a switch installed at the bottom of the push plate 2 at a specified angle, which in turn sends a command to the negative pressure extraction unit 608, causing the suction cup 609 to disengage from the resistor body 5. After the second retreat, the pawl of the push-pull plate 701 cooperates with the second ratchet 709 to rotate the second ratchet 709. When the second ratchet 709 rotates, it drives the first gear to rotate. At the same time, the engagement of the first gear and the second gear drives the second gear to rotate synchronously in the opposite direction. At the same time, the second gear drives the worm 704 in the opposite direction through the transmission chain 703, and the corresponding worm gear 705 and the winding roller 706 also rotate in the opposite direction. In fact, a reversing valve is set between the negative pressure extraction unit 608 and the suction cup 609. When negative pressure is required, the reversing valve connects the negative pressure extraction unit 608 to the suction cup 609. When pressure relief is required, the reversing valve connects the suction cup 609 to the atmosphere. The switch here is a travel switch, which sends instructions to the reversing valve.
[0101] When the reeling roller 706 rotates in the opposite direction, the pulling steel cable 707 is unwound, and at the same time, under the action of the gravity of the supporting base pipe 601 and related parts on the supporting base pipe 601, the supporting base pipe 601 descends.
[0102] Finally, the pushing plate 2 moves forward to push the sprayed resistor body 5 onto the conveying assembly.
[0103] Among them, when the push plate 2 moves backward, it drives the push-pull plate 701 to move backward, and the pawl of the push-pull plate 701 cooperates with the second ratchet 709 or the first ratchet 702. It can only cooperate with one at a time, and when cooperating with the other, it disengages from the currently cooperating second ratchet 709 or the first ratchet 702.

[0105] The spraying mechanism includes a support frame 3 fixed on the conveying platform 101, on which two synchronously driven No. 1 electric push rods 302 are fixed, and the outer wall spraying parts 304 are fixed on the movable rods of the two No. 1 electric push rods 302, and a No. 1 nozzle 306 is arranged on one side of the outer wall spraying parts 304.
[0106] An inner wall spraying part 305 communicating with the outer wall spraying part 304 is fixed thereon, and a second nozzle 307 is arranged at the end of the inner wall spraying part 305 .
[0107] In an embodiment of the present invention, two material storage boxes 301 are fixed on the support frame 3, and a discharge bucket 309 connected to the bottom of the two material storage boxes 301 is fixed. The discharge bucket 309 is connected to the outer wall spray part 304 through the conveying pipe 303 to supply paint to the outer wall spray part 304 through the material storage box 301 and the conveying pipe 303, and the outer wall spray part 304 is integrated with the power components required for spraying.
[0108] When the outer wall spraying part 304 is working, the resistor body 5 is sprayed through the second nozzle 307 and the first nozzle 306 at the same time.
[0109] See also Figure 15 The angle of the second nozzle 307 is arranged with the middle one gradually tilted toward both sides.
[0110] Among them, when the No. 1 electric push rod 302 is working, the outer wall spraying part 304 is driven to rise / fall by extending / retracting the movable rod. When spraying is required, the outer wall spraying part 304 falls, and the outer wall spraying part 304 rises after spraying is completed. In order to avoid the inner wall spraying part 305 from shaking during the lifting and lowering of the outer wall spraying part 304, which causes the spraying position to change, a reinforcement frame 308 fixed to the inner wall spraying part 305 is installed on the outer wall spraying part 304, and the inner wall spraying part 305 is reinforced by the reinforcement frame 308.
[0111] An embedding groove is provided on the top of the supporting base tube 601 , in which a baffle 6010 is slidably installed. A spring 6011 is fixed to the bottom of the baffle 6010 . One end of the spring 6011 is fixed to the bottom of the embedding groove, and the other end is fixed to the bottom of the baffle 6010 .
[0112] In an embodiment of the present invention, under normal conditions, the baffle 6010 is in contact with the bottom of the conveying platform 101. When the supporting base tube 601 rises, the spring 6011 is compressed, causing the baffle 6010 to shrink into the embedded groove. When the baffle 6010 descends, the elastic potential energy stored when the spring 6011 is compressed is released to drive the baffle 6010 to extend. Through this structure, the baffle 6010 can always be in contact with the bottom of the conveying platform 101.
[0113] The purpose of this abutment is that since the resistor body 5 is sprayed on the inner wall during spraying, a small amount of paint will splash. In order to prevent the paint from affecting the normal operation of the components, the paint is collected through the supporting base tube 601. A sealing cover can be removably installed at the bottom of the supporting base tube 601, and the paint in the supporting base tube 601 can be cleaned by removing the sealing cover.
[0114] Through the above structure, it can be achieved that the through port 104 is always connected with the inside of the carrier base tube 601 .
[0115] A gap portion 102 is provided on the conveying platform 101 , and the gap portion 102 is coaxially arranged with the through opening 104 .
[0116] The end of the conveying platform 101 is further provided with an inclined portion 103 .
[0117] In the embodiment of the present invention, the gap 102 is provided to increase the distance between the resistor body 5 and the inner wall of the conveying platform 101 , thereby preventing friction between the resistor body 5 and the inner wall of the retention box 1 during the spraying process.
[0118] The inclined portion 103 can smoothly push the resistor body 5 onto the conveying assembly after spraying the resistor body 5 is completed.
[0119] When in use (working), the resistor body 5 is pushed to the position of the through opening 104 by the pushing plate 2, and then the resistor body 5 is slightly lifted up by the driving mechanism and the resistor body 5 is adsorbed at the same time. Subsequently, the spraying mechanism descends to spray the inner and outer walls of the resistor body 5, while driving the resistor body 5 to rotate.
[0120] After spraying is completed, the resistor body 5 is pushed to the conveying assembly again by the pushing plate 2, and the conveying assembly conveys the sprayed resistor body 5 to the next process, during which the paint attached to the resistor body 5 is further dried.
